Job description

Position: Butler (PT Community Waste Collector)
Reports to: Area Supervisor (AS)/ Field Quality Manager (FQM)
Level: Entry Level (Non-Exempt role)
Who WE are:
Trash Butler is the sustainability expert and revolutionary doorstep valet trash service and recycling solution designed for multi-family apartment communities. We currently service over 250,000+ units across 35 states in the country and have been voted one of the top amenities by residents and property managers. Trash Butler has been featured in The Wall Street Journal, TIME Magazine and on CNBC. We pride ourselves on providing stress-free service and professional employees who make a difference every day. We are committed to providing a culture that embraces our four Core Values which include: Building Leaders; Always Branding; Listen, Fulfill and Delight; and Creating a Fun, Enthusiastic and Safe Team Environment.
Who YOU are:
You are responsible for the nightly doorstep collection of trash/recycling at one of the many apartment communities we service.

No experience required; we will train the right person! Just have a great attitude and meet the minimum requirements.

Schedule*: 8pm until finished, 2-3 hours of work on average - Service starts at 8:00pm SHARP!
Days: Must have availably to work any day
Pay: Depends on your community
Incentives: Referral Bonus Programs

The main function of this role will be to ensure that nightly trash pick-up is completed on your assigned community per schedule to 100% satisfaction of our Clients!
ESSENTIA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:

• Responsible for ensuring satisfactory completion of doorstep trash/recycling collection on service evenings using the trash tote or cart* to collect bagged trash from each resident doorstep *trash totes are used on most of our communities
• Transport trash from your open-bed pick-up truck or cart and dispose of in the dumpster/shut on site
• Nightly use of Trash Butler's proprietary field app to track timekeeping, check in/out of the community, report resident non-compliance, and submit nightly reports
• Maintain daily contact with your supervisor/manager
• Work quietly and efficiently keeping noise to a minimum so not to disturb residents
• Other duties as assigned

M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S:

• Must be able to lift up to 50lbs and use hands and arms repetitively
• Be able to climb stairs; 3-4 story apartment buildings
• Be able to bend/twist at the waist and potentially reach above shoulder level
• Be able to walk the distance of an apartment community
• Be able to work outdoors and be exposed to various weather conditions
• Must have a valid driver's license/auto insurance for properties where truck is required
• Must have a cell phone (Smart Phone) to download our app
• Be self-motivated, reliable, and able to work independently
• Be able to work efficiently without sacrificing quality of service
• Embody our core values: Building Leaders - Always Branding - Fun, Enthusiastic Team Environment - Listen, Fulfill & Delight

REQUIRED EDUCATION & EXPERIENCE:

• High school diploma or equivalent
• Basic employee relations experience
• Experience providing customer service

Offer of employment is contingent upon the candidate successfully passing a pre-employment criminal background check and clean driving history.
